I recall an interview with Bill Wallace talking about this fight. It was clear that he just didn't 'get' screen fighting at all. He commented that he was annoyed and felt awkward because the choreography allowed Jackie to keep getting through with his "Wing Chun".

Kinda odd that considering that there is no Wing Chun in the fight, and for the most part Jackie gets his arse kicked.

Does anyone remember, in the U.S. version, where Wallace says: "Come on, big boy" to Jackie Chan?

Bill Wallace used to write articles SLAMMING Jackie Chan. He made it a point to let the world know that he didn't do the motorcycle stunt in PROTECTOR. This was around the the release of RUMBLE IN THE BRONX where he was being tagged "the guy that does his own stunts"...

Did Jackie Chan re-film some of this scene? Or was this all filmed during the same schedule and just re-edited by Jackie?

Link to comment
Share on other sites

  • Member

Refilmed after the director left he called Bill wallace back as far as i kno to shoot alonger fighter scene for hk audience and added some comedy to the film.
